Job Summary The Director of Plant Operations is responsible for the overall management of hospital facilities, plant maintenance, safety, and regulatory compliance. This includes oversight of physical plant infrastructure, mechanical and environmental systems, safety programs, emergency preparedness, and construction management. The role ensures that the hospital environment is safe, operational, and aligned with organizational standards, budget objectives, and applicable regulations. Essential Functions Directs and evaluates operations including construction, plant maintenance, groundskeeping, and security. Develops and oversees departmental budgets, vendor contracts, and performance metrics. Ensures compliance with TJC, OSHA, NFPA, CMS, and other local/state/federal regulatory agencies. Serves as facility Safety Officer and chairperson for Environment of Care (EOC) Committee. Plans and executes facility emergency preparedness drills and liaises with Homeland Security and FEMA. Oversees infrastructure maintenance programs, including HVAC, boiler, electrical, fire safety, and life safety systems. Coordinates audits and inspections for safety and facilities readiness. Manages staff recruitment, training, scheduling, performance evaluations, and corrective actions. Collaborates with hospital leadership to support strategic facilities planning. Provides leadership in continuous improvement for safety, quality, and operational efficiency. Knowledge/Skills/Abilities/Expectations Strong knowledge of hospital facilities operations, life safety codes, and emergency preparedness. Technical skills in HVAC, boilers, electrical systems, fire safety, and building systems. Proficiency in interpreting architectural plans and compliance standards. Effective leadership and team-building skills. Critical thinking and problem-solving in high-pressure situations. Excellent verbal and written communication. Ability to manage multiple priorities and projects concurrently. Comfortable with data analysis, budgeting, and strategic planning. Familiarity with computerized maintenance management systems (CMMS). Qualifications Education High School Diploma or GED Equivalent (Required). Associate's or Bachelor's Degree in Engineering, Facilities Management, Environmental Services, Business, or related field (Preferred). Licenses/Certifications Certified Healthcare Safety Professional (CHSP) or relevant certifications preferred. Facility may require licensure to be obtained. Experience Minimum two (2) years of experience in hospital maintenance or a related environment. Supervisory experience required. Ten (10) years preferred in healthcare facilities operations.
